Output 070ed5837bbcc42275285574c10854f278301ca1a83f174637adf733e83ae67c:1

value
179886104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b00fb4d61b3e37c4bad9e35621eb790cdb0a570 OP_EQUAL
address
3LCQGh4ZrKy2qnYBndaNNt52URXMFKME7t
transaction
070ed5837bbcc42275285574c10854f278301ca1a83f174637adf733e83ae67c
confirmations
511718
spent
true